A little fog and some misting didn’t deter Walkers from converging on the Oakland Zoo, on Sunday, October 14, 2012, for JDRF’s Walk to Cure Diabetes. Kids and parents alike had a tremendous time walking and viewing the animals, frolicking in the meadow (even some tossing of a football or two) and taking advantage of a great day.

The photos reflect on how much fun everyone had as well as a testament to a very successful day for raising funds to find a cure for T1D. To date, more than $375,000 has been raised to benefit T1D research. There’s still time to donate and help us meet our goal! JustĀ click here.
